Este es el código, no sé por qué da error. x e y son del mismo tipo, y puede ejecutar y.tocoo() pero x no puede. Cuando ejecuto este código en Google Colab, no tiene ningún error. ¿Me puedes ayudar? ipdb > x = scipy.sparse.lil_matrix(y.shape) ipdb > x.rows = preds_k ipdb . . . Read more
Tengo un lote, dos datos de matrices multidimensionales (3,3,2) de la siguiente manera: batch= np.asarray([ [ [[1,2,3], [3,1,1,], [4,9,0,]], [[2,2,2], [5,6,7], [3,3,3]] ], [ [[2,2,2], [5,6,7], [3,3,3]], [[1,2,3], [3,1,1], [4,9,0]] ] ]) Con un correspondiente lote, dos datos, de (1,1,2) de la siguiente manera: scalers = np.asarray([ [ [[1]], [[2]] . . . Read more
Quiero generar números aleatorios que sigan una Distribución Erlang para un proceso de llegada. Quiero establecer el número de llegadas k como parámetro de la Distribución Erlang. No estoy muy seguro qué significa loc y scale, ya que en la documentación no aclaran realmente lo que representan. Cualquier ayuda sería . . . Read more
Quiero guardar una lista de arrays de NumPy como un archivo mat, pero se presentó el error 'list' object has no attribute 'items'. Puedes ver mi intento a continuación: import numpy as np import scipy.io output=[] for i in range(10): a=np.random.randint(0,100,size=(60,60,4)) output.append(a) scipy.io.savemat(‘test.mat’, output)
Después de investigar, por ahora, entiendo que scipy tiene un sistema de coordenadas de eje derecho y rotación de mano izquierda. Por ejemplo: python from scipy.spatial.transform import Rotation as R np.array([0,1,0]) @ R.from_euler("XYZ", [0,0,30], degrees=True).as_matrix() # debería ser [0.5,sqrt(3)/2,0] Pero no puedo entender la diferencia entre la rotación extrínseca y . . . Read more